Default Scraped my Rim..what to do?

Stupid me, I was pulling out of school on my lunch break and I wasnt really paying attention. I scraped my front right rim.. Luckily it isnt that bad but I still need to do something about it. Its on the very outer edge of the rim and its probably 2-3 inches long. I dont want to touch it before I get some ideas from you guys.

I was hoping there would be some products out there to smoothen it out and maybe some sort of touch up paints?

I did the same thing and I'm just gonna polish all four rims. It could be fixed very easily by a wheel repair shop but I've been debating over the polishing anyway so this made my decision for me. I know a good wheel polishing guy here in town. Only problem is he's slow, last time he had my rims for a full week. But when you get them back, it's worth it.

If you want to take the DIY approach, grind it smooth with a dremel tool. It should be easy since it is minor. Be sure not to take too much metal off. Then refinish with as close a color you can find. You'll know it's there but nobody else will probably notice it.
